- 1.A circular coin has a diameter of 3 cm. Work out the circumference of the coin. Give your answer in terms of π.
- 2.A circular pizza base has a radius of 12 cm. Work out the area of the pizza base. Use π = 3.14.
- 3.A circular coaster has a radius of 4 cm. Work out the circumference of the coaster. Give your answer in terms of π.
- 4.A gardener wants to buy edging trim to go all the way around a circular flower bed with a diameter of 8 m. Work out the length of edging trim needed, using π = 3.14. Give your answer to the nearest metre.
- 5.A circular tabletop has a radius of 15 cm. Work out the area of the tabletop. Use π = 3.14. Give your answer to 1 decimal place.
- 6.A birthday cake is a cylinder of radius 10 cm and height 8 cm, with a thin ribbon fixed exactly once around the curved side, at half the height, and joined with no overlap. Work out the length of ribbon needed. Use π = 3.14.
- 7.A party hat is in the shape of a cone with a base radius of 6 cm and a slant height of 10 cm. Work out the curved surface area of the party hat. Use π = 3.14 and the formula curved surface area = πrl.
- 8.A solid cone has a base radius of 6 cm and a vertical height of 10 cm. Work out the volume of the cone. Use π = 3.14 and give your answer correct to 1 decimal place.
- 9.A rectangular garden bed measures 5 m by 3 m. A semicircular flower border is attached along one of the 3 m-wide ends, on the outside of the rectangle, so that the 3 m side is the diameter of the semicircle. Work out the total perimeter of the combined shape (the two long sides, the one remaining short side, and the curved edge). Use π = 3.14.
- 10.An ice cream is made from a cone of radius 3 cm and height 10 cm, topped with a hemisphere of the same radius sitting exactly on top of the cone. Work out the total volume of the ice cream. Use π = 3.14. Give your answer to the nearest whole number. Volume of a cone = 1/3 × πr²h. Volume of a sphere = 4/3 × πr³.
- 11.A cylindrical water tank has a solid hemispherical dome on top, both with radius 2 m. Work out the volume of the hemispherical dome alone. Use π = 3.14 and give your answer correct to 3 decimal places.
- 12.A circular clock face has a radius of 9 cm. Work out the circumference of the clock face. Use π = 3.14. Give your answer to 1 decimal place.
- 13.A composite solid is made from a cylinder of radius 3 cm and height 10 cm, with a cone of the same radius and vertical height 4 cm fixed on top, apex upward. Work out the total volume of the solid. Use π = 3.14 and give your answer correct to 1 decimal place.
- 14.A solid metal sphere has a radius of 5 cm. It is melted down and recast into a solid cylinder with the same radius, 5 cm. Work out the height of the cylinder, so that its volume equals the volume of the sphere. Use π = 3.14 and give your answer correct to 1 decimal place.
- 15.A solid ball has a radius of 7 cm. Work out the surface area of the ball. Use π = 3.14.
